Press ESC to close

Topics on SEO & BacklinksTopics on SEO & Backlinks

The Evolution of Computer Systems: From Mainframes to Cloud Computing

computer systems have evolved significantly over the years, from the massive mainframes of the 1950s to the distributed cloud computing systems of today. This evolution has been driven by advancements in technology, changes in computing needs, and the demand for greater efficiency and scalability. In this article, we will explore the journey of computer systems, from mainframes to cloud computing, and the impact IT has had on businesses and individuals alike.

Mainframes: The Early Days

Mainframe computers were the primary computing platforms in the 1950s and 1960s. These large, centralized systems were used by government agencies, large corporations, and academic institutions for tasks such as census data processing, business applications, and scientific calculations. Mainframes were characterized by their massive size, high processing power, and often required specialized operators to manage and use them.

One of the most famous mainframe computers of the time was the IBM System/360, which was introduced in 1964. The System/360 was a family of mainframe computers that offered a wide range of processing power and input/output capabilities, making IT suitable for a variety of applications. The introduction of the System/360 marked a significant milestone in the history of computing, as IT standardized the architecture of mainframe computers and set the stage for future innovations in the field.

Mini and Microcomputers: The Rise of Personal Computing

In the 1970s and 1980s, the advent of mini and microcomputers revolutionized the computing industry. These smaller, more affordable systems brought computing power to individuals and small businesses, enabling them to perform tasks that were previously only possible on mainframe systems. Companies like Apple and IBM played a significant role in popularizing personal computing with the introduction of the Apple II and IBM PC, respectively.

The rise of personal computing also led to the development of operating systems such as MS-DOS and Windows, as well as software applications like word processors, spreadsheets, and databases. These advancements made computing more accessible to a broader audience and revolutionized the way people worked and communicated.

Client-Server Computing: The Shift to Distributed Systems

As the demand for computing power and networking capabilities grew, so did the need for distributed systems that could handle the increasing complexity of business applications and data management. Client-server computing emerged as a solution to this need, with the separation of processing between client machines and server machines. This architecture allowed for greater scalability, improved performance, and better resource utilization.

During this time, the development of networking technologies such as Ethernet and the internet played a crucial role in connecting client machines to server machines, enabling data sharing and communication on a global scale. Companies began to invest in enterprise-level servers and database systems to support their growing computing needs, leading to the rise of companies like Oracle, Microsoft, and IBM in the enterprise computing market.

The Emergence of Cloud Computing

Cloud computing represents the latest phase in the evolution of computer systems, offering a new paradigm for the delivery and consumption of computing resources. Cloud computing enables users to access a wide range of services, including storage, processing power, and applications, over the internet on a pay-as-you-go basis.

One of the key drivers of cloud computing is virtualization technology, which allows for the creation of virtual machines and virtualized resources within a physical server. This enables greater flexibility and efficiency in resource allocation, as well as the ability to scale computing resources on demand. Companies like Amazon, Google, and Microsoft have established themselves as major players in the cloud computing market, offering a variety of services through their respective platforms (AWS, Google Cloud, and Azure).

Conclusion

The evolution of computer systems from mainframes to cloud computing has transformed the way we live and work. Advances in technology have made computing more accessible, scalable, and efficient than ever before. From the isolated mainframe systems of the past to the globally connected cloud platforms of today, the journey of computer systems reflects the continual pursuit of innovation and improvement in the field of computing.

FAQs

Q: What is the difference between mainframe and cloud computing?

A: Mainframe computing involves the use of a large, centralized system to process and manage data, while cloud computing utilizes distributed resources over the internet to provide on-demand services and resources.

Q: How has cloud computing impacted businesses?

A: Cloud computing has enabled businesses to reduce their IT infrastructure costs, improve scalability and flexibility, and increase collaboration and accessibility to computing resources.

Q: What are some examples of cloud computing services?

A: Examples of cloud computing services include infrastructure as a service (IaaS), platform as a service (PaaS), and software as a service (SaaS), which offer various levels of computing resources and applications over the internet.

As computer systems continue to evolve, the possibilities for innovation and growth in the field of computing are limitless. Whether IT‘s the development of new hardware technologies, the advancement of software applications, or the expansion of cloud computing services, the future of computing holds great promise for businesses and individuals around the world.